python大连示例 openpyxl 新建sheet并进行编辑
时间: 2023-07-21 08:27:16 浏览: 111
好的,下面是使用 openpyxl 库在 Python 中新建一个 Excel 文件,并在其中添加一个新的 sheet 并进行编辑的示例代码:
```python
# 导入 openpyxl 库
import openpyxl
# 创建一个新的 Excel 文件
wb = openpyxl.Workbook()
# 获取默认的 sheet
sheet = wb.active
# 修改 sheet 名称
sheet.title = 'Sheet1'
# 新建一个 sheet
new_sheet = wb.create_sheet(title='Sheet2')
# 在新 sheet 中写入数据
new_sheet['A1'] = 'Name'
new_sheet['B1'] = 'Age'
new_sheet['C1'] = 'Gender'
new_sheet['A2'] = 'Tom'
new_sheet['B2'] = 20
new_sheet['C2'] = 'Male'
new_sheet['A3'] = 'Lucy'
new_sheet['B3'] = 25
new_sheet['C3'] = 'Female'
# 保存 Excel 文件
wb.save('example.xlsx')
```
运行以上代码后,会在当前目录下生成一个名为 `example.xlsx` 的 Excel 文件,并在其中包含两个 sheet,分别为 `Sheet1` 和 `Sheet2`,其中 `Sheet2` 中包含了一些数据。
相关问题
openpyxl新建工作表,示例
使用openpyxl库,可以方便地对Excel文件进行操作。下面是一个使用openpyxl创建一个新工作表的示例:
首先,需要安装openpyxl库。在命令行中输入以下命令即可完成安装:
```python
pip install openpyxl
```
然后,可以使用以下代码创建一个新的工作簿,并在其中添加一个新的工作表:
```python
import openpyxl
# 创建一个新的工作簿
workbook = openpyxl.Workbook()
# 添加一个新的工作表
new_sheet = workbook.create_sheet(title='NewSheet')
# 保存工作簿
workbook.save('new_example.xlsx')
```
在上述代码中,`openpyxl.Workbook()`用于创建一个新的工作簿,`workbook.create_sheet(title='NewSheet')`用于在工作簿中创建一个新的工作表,`workbook.save('new_example.xlsx')`则将工作簿保存为一个名为'new_example.xlsx'的Excel文件。
阅读全文